超速报警 = 0x0001,
疲劳驾驶报警 = 0x0002,
紧急报警 = 0x0003,
进入指定区域报警 = 0x0004,
离开指定区域报警 = 0x0005,
越界报警 = 0x0008,
盗警 = 0x0009,
劫警 = 0x000A,
偏离路线报警 = 0x000B,
车辆移动报警 = 0x000C,
超时驾驶报警 = 0x000D,
违规行驶报警 = 0x0010,
前撞报警 = 0x0011,
车道偏离报警 = 0x0012,
胎压异常报警 = 0x0013,
动态信息异常报警 = 0x0014,
其他报警 = 0x000E,

超时停车=0xA001,
车辆定位信息上报时间间隔异常 = 0xA002,
车辆定位信息上报距离间隔异常 = 0xA003,
下级平台异常断线 = 0xA004,
下级平台数据传输异常 = 0xA005,
路段堵塞报警 = 0xA006,
危险路段报警 = 0xA007,
雨雪天气报警 = 0xA008,
驾驶员身份识别异常 = 0xA009,
终端异常 = 0xA00A,
平台接入异常 = 0xA00B,
核心数据异常 = 0xA00C,
其他报警1 = 0xA0FF,
}
